grub2 与 grub 的区别

官方手册:https://www.gnu.org/software/grub/manual/grub/html_node/Changes-from-GRUB-Legacy.html#Changes-from-GRUB-Legacy

几个主要的区别:
1.配置文件的名称改变了。在grub中,配置文件为grub.conf或menu.lst(grub.conf的一个软链接),在grub2中改名为grub.cfg。
2.grub2增添了许多语法,更接近于脚本语言了,例如支持变量、条件判断、循环。
3.grub2使用img文件,不再使用grub中的stage1、stage1.5和stage2。

grub2 引导操作系统的方式

官方手册:https://www.gnu.org/software/grub/manual/grub/html_node/General-boot-methods.html#General-boot-methods

直接引导:(direct-load)直接通过默认的grub2 boot loader来引导写在默认配置文件中的操作系统
链式引导:(chain-load)使用默认grub2 boot loader链式引导另一个boot loader,该boot loader将引导对应的操作系统

EFI system partition(ESP)

EFI系统分区(也称为ESP)是一个操作系统独立分区,作为EFI引导加载程序、应用程序和驱动程序的存储空间,由UEFI固件启动。UEFI引导时必须配置。

The disk's partition table: it indicates Disklabel type: gpt if the partition table is GPT or Disklabel type: dos if it is MBR.
The list of partitions on the disk: Look for the EFI system partition in the list, it is usually at least 100 MiB in size and has the type EFI System or EFI (FAT-12/16/32). To confirm this is the ESP, mount it and check whether it contains a directory named EFI, if it does this is definitely the ESP.
